Quality Control Chemist

Position Title: Quality Control Chemist Department: Quality Control
Reports To: Supervisor of Quality Control Work Location: Decatur, Illinois

Position Summary:
• Perform the sampling of raw materials, chemical and physical analysis of raw material, bulk formulations, finished products, stability samples, and any non-routine samples.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
• Sampling and testing of raw materials per approved procedure.
• Physical and chemical testing of bulk and (pre-fill, finished product, and stability) product.
• Upkeep of laboratory notebook.
• Maintaining the work area in an orderly manner.
• Maintaining Lab inventory like list of standards, chemical, reagent etc.
• Recording daily activity like PH verification, balance verification, temperature and humidity monitoring of lab stability chambers, freezer, refrigerator etc.
• Experience in the operation of handling QC major instruments like HPLC, GC, UV, IR, Auto titrator, etc.
• Perform Finished product/in-process/cleaning validation and raw material analysis independently. Complete testing within specified timeframes and document results accurately
• Coordinate with vendor for instrument PM, calibration and qualification activity. Provide necessary support.
• Maintain and monitor lab GLP activity like instrument calibration/qualification schedule, Preparation of instrument operating procedure, coordinate with metrology team and vendor for scheduling period calibration/qualification activity etc.
• Performs calibration of lab instruments whenever possible.
• Cleaning of laboratory glassware.
• Responsible for writing SOP for instrument operation/ calibration etc.
• Provide necessary support for OOS/OOT investigation.
• Preparation of stability schedule, Protocol, and report per ICH requirements.
• Adhere to regulatory guidelines (e.g., FDA, ICH, GMP) and company quality standards during testing and documentation.
• Ensure adherence to Good Laboratory Practices (GLP), Good Documentation Practices (GDP), and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) during testing procedure.

Education and Experience:
• Bachelor’s Degree from a four-year accredited college or university with a Major in Chemistry or equivalent.
• Prefer, two years of industry experience involving analytical or wet chemistry test procedures in a quality control environment.
• Experience with, Infra-Red (IR), Ultraviolet/Visible Spectroscopy, Particle Size Analysis, KF Titration, and wet chemistry skills are required.
• Familiarity with High Pressure Liquid Chromatography, Gas Chromatography (GC), and HPLC/GC analytical software is preferred, but not required.
• Familiarity with GLP/GMP guidelines.
• Good Communication and writing skills.
• Familiarity with out-of-specification (OOS) investigation.
• Computer literate.
• Experience with USP/EP monographs.
